What Are Tanning Peptides?

At their core, tanning peptides like Melanotan II are designed to mimic the actions of a natural hormone in the body, *alpha-melanocyte-stimulating hormone* (α-MSH)2025年9月12日—Melanotan II (MT-II) is a tanning peptidethat stimulates melanin production, helping users achieve a darker skin tone with less sun exposure.. This hormone plays a vital role in regulating the production of melanin, the pigment responsible for skin and hair colorTanning Injections: Risks, Side Effects, and Precautions. By stimulating melanogenesis, Melanotan II and its counterparts can lead to a darker skin tone with less, or even without, sun exposure. This mechanism was initially explored as a potential method to combat skin cancer by providing a protective tan without relying on UV radiation. In fact, Melanotan I has been shown to act synergistically with UV-B light or sunlight to enhance the tanning response.

How Do They Work?

The Legal Landscape and Availability

A significant concern surrounding tanning peptide injections is their legal status. In many regions, including the United States, these products are currently illegal to buy. Potential Risks and Side Effects

While the cosmetic benefits of a tan may seem desirable, the risks associated with tanning injections are substantial and widely reported by health authorities.
